## Extension physical-footprint budget
|
||||
|
||||
`phys_footprint` is the primary extension metric because device jetsam follows
|
||||
it more closely than RSS. `KeyboardExtensionMemoryTelemetry` records structured
|
||||
`[OSGDiag/memory] extMemory` lines at lifecycle and heavy-resource milestones,
|
||||
plus 50 ms samples during the first four seconds:
|
||||
|
||||
- **Normal:** below 36 MiB
|
||||
- **Warning:** 36–40 MiB
|
||||
- **High:** 40–48 MiB; 40 MiB is the internal safe peak
|
||||
- **Critical:** 48 MiB or above
|
||||
|
||||
The approximate 60 MiB device boundary is not a public Apple contract. The
|
||||
40 MiB target deliberately reserves room for transient SwiftUI, Rime, and
|
||||
system-framework pages. Telemetry is observation-only: crossing a band logs
|
||||
`crossed=1` but does not change the selected surface or unload resources.
|
||||
|
||||
Each record includes the current and peak footprint, delta from process start,
|
||||
elapsed startup time, surface/language, Full Access, clipboard state, and
|
||||
operation-specific context. Filter Console by `OSGDiag/memory` and compare:
|
||||
|
||||
1. `KVC.viewDidLoad.afterInstallServices`
|
||||
2. `KVC.viewDidLoad.afterInstallSwiftUI`
|
||||
3. `typing.englishPrepare.done`
|
||||
4. `typing.rimePrepare.done`
|
||||
5. `clipboard.reload.done`
|
||||
6. `KVC.viewDidAppear.done`
|
